Terrible redesign

The 2025-26 redesign is an unusable mess. It depends heavily on location and has poor real-time access while in the subway, which was better with the previous version. You lose a lot of the system map, while you’re traveling in system, making it harder to anticipate upcoming stops on unfamiliar lines. Findability is really poor. It’s also difficult to find line-specific maps. If a long-time New Yorker struggles with it, I don’t know how a tourist would succeed in using this version.

Oops, all bugs

Bus stops don’t always display even if you are stand at one. No widgets, no ability to check schedule in the absence of real time updates (which drop out a few times a day on most lines). Reduced the features from the previous incarnation. Download Transit.
